Two cars are approaching an intersection on roads that are perpendicular to each other. Car A is north of the intersection and traveling south at 60 mph. Car B is east of the intersection and traveling west at 45 mph. How fast is the distance between the cars changing when car A is 14 miles from the intersection and car B is 48 miles from the intersection? (Round your answer to two decimal places.) mph?
